About the Employer: Polden Bower is a 160-place special school and has the specialist resources needed to meet the needs of our students. State-of-the-art facilities for all the children and young people include a warm water pool for physiotherapy, a sports hall, a sensory room, and fully accessible classrooms with the latest teaching technology. This is a very exciting time to be joining a growing Federation. We are working in partnership with The Bridge School, which is the PRU within Bridgwater.

You will be providing IT support for Staff and Students across 6 sites in Bridgwater and Street. This could range from delivery hardware to classes. On a day-to-day basis, you will be assisting on our helpdesk with IT requests for staff, as well as helping with maintenance and upgrades.

The apprenticeship is a flexible, blended learning programme designed to upskill IT professionals in designing, installing, maintaining, and supporting communication networks. The programme combines advanced training, expert mentorship, and the latest tools to prepare learners for success in a high-demand field.

The training you’ll be provided with:

  • Comprehensive digital introductory modules including technical concepts and personal/professional development
  • Level 4 Network Engineer apprenticeship standard e-learning training materials
  • Specialist CompTIA vendor qualifications
  • Virtual classroom training on the CompTIA Network+ certification
  • Access to uCertify training platform; core learning materials, assessments, and practical hands-on-labs
  • Monthly assessor visits and competency checks
  • 9 am - 5 pm Support desk for technical support
